Transaction f15f890a3b0d2681ca185d08c9a208d9eb212d75f0252c5fbde97c28c64255c1
1 Input
1 Output
-
f15f890a3b0d2681ca185d08c9a208d9eb212d75f0252c5fbde97c28c64255c1:0
- value
- 1043157
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4035bd3b8595e9df6722e6b5eb1f3782e1c802a
- address
- bc1q6sp4h5act90fmanj9e44av0n0qhpeqp2gumk5p